What this AI tool does

Freepik AI is the AI-powered creative toolset within Freepik for generating, editing, enhancing, and adapting visual assets for designers, marketers, content creators, and teams that need production-ready imagery quickly. It sits on top of Freepik’s wider design-resource ecosystem, so its role is not only to create new images from prompts, but also to help users move from idea to usable graphic without leaving a visual workflow. For users who already rely on Freepik for stock photos, vectors, mockups, icons, and templates, the AI layer feels like a natural extension of the marketplace. Instead of searching only for a finished asset, users can generate images, modify existing visuals, expand a composition, clean up details, or adapt material for a specific campaign style. This makes the platform especially useful when the right visual does not exist yet, or when a found asset is close but needs adjustment. What users say

Findings from public reviews, documentation and community sources.

  • Ease of use

    A Reddit heavy user says “if your animation needs are simple, freepik is great,” while another Reddit user describes Freepik AI as “Extrelemy clunky” with “slow loads” and “frequent ‘load errors.’”

  • Features

    The Freepik pricing page lists “Access to all image, video & audio models,” “Pro editing tools: image, video & design,” “Music, voice & sound effects generation,” and “250M+ photos, videos, vectors & PSDs.” The Freepik pricing page names models including Seedream, Flux, Kling, and Runway.

  • Pricing

    The Freepik pricing page lists annual prices including Premium at “£10.50 /month,” Premium+ at “£24 /month,” Pro at “£150 /month,” and Business at “£41.50 /seat/month.” The Freepik pricing page also lists annual credit amounts including “240K credits /year” and “600K credits /year.”

  • Integrations

    The Freepik plan page includes “Magnific MCP & plugins,” “API access with credit-based usage,” enterprise “SSO,” and an “API access” section for integrating AI into tools and workflows. Make says users can “Connect Freepik to Make to automate your asset creation and distribution.”

  • Support

    The Freepik pricing page says Enterprise Magnific Studios “Includes training, live Q&A, and priority support from a dedicated team.”

What privacy or compliance checks should I consider before using Freepik AI?
Teams should review Freepik AI’s current privacy, data-use, and licensing terms before uploading sensitive or client-owned visuals. Important checks include how uploaded images are processed, whether prompts or assets may be used for service improvement, what commercial rights apply, and whether internal approval is needed for regulated or confidential work.
